SEO and PPC Should Work Together
While search engine optimisation (SEO) and search engine pay per click (PPC) advertising are two different marketing functions, they ultimately have the same goal: website clicks that drive conversions
Some website owners choose to deploy one or the other, depending on their goals and budget, but ideally you should be doing both to capitalise on the benefits of each.
While some website owners get this, and are investing in both, they still might be missing a huge opportunity.
If you’re able to invest in both, it’s important to integrate the SEO and PPC campaigns and ensure that your SEO team and PPC team are working together and communicating regularly.

How to Write Effective CTAs on Social Media: A Guide for Marketers
Do you recall the last time you were compelled to sign up for a free one-month trial or download a guide?
That was an effective call to action, or a CTA.
A good CTA can do wonders in the marketing world—it can drive more visitors to your content, generate sales, and increase leads and conversion rates.
A CTA prompts the reader to do something—sign up for a subscription, download an e-book, attend an event, click for more information, and so on.
It’s about providing your reader with an actionable task, most often appearing as a button, in-text link, or an image, answering the question “Now what?”

TV Ad Revenues Down 2.72% In The Six Months To December
You know things are grim in Australia’s TV business when Network Ten boss Paul Anderson (as he did last week), comes out and says the business is “under severe duress"
Ad revenues to the free-to-air (FTA) players, SBS, MCN and Foxtel fell by 2.72% to $2.2 billion in the six months to December 2016, Think TV has revealed.
It follows on from Channel Seven’s half-yearly results last week that saw profits tank 91%.

Honeyweb Staff Introductions: Steven Hamilton
Steven Hamilton (Managing Director of Honeyweb Online Marketing Solutions)
Steven is an ex AFL/SANFL professional footballer, having played for the North Melbourne Kangaroos and the North Adelaide Roosters. He played in the successful North Adelaide premiership team in 1991.
Due to injuries, Steven decided to retire from professional football and concentrate on a career in design, illustration and sales.
It was during this time Steven discovered a little thing called the Internet. Instantly seeing its potential, he quickly joined Global Internet Directories as a sales agent and soon excelled, winning the “Australasian Sales Achievement Award for 1997.”
With Steven’s design background, it soon became apparent the majority of websites were being designed by computer experts and lacked the professional appearance produced in traditional media. It was time for this to change, and Steven most certainly achieved this.
Establishing his first online marketing agency in 1998, and Honeyweb PTY LTD in July 2007, Steven has nearly 20 years' experience developing successful online marketing solutions for well over 500 clients.
